French edit

Etymology edit

From pin(eau) +‎ -ard.

Pronunciation edit

  • IPA(key): /pi.naʁ/
  • (file)

Noun edit

pinard m (plural pinards)

  1. (colloquial, derogatory) plonk (cheap wine)
    Synonyms: gros bleu, gros qui tache, gros rouge, petit bleu, picrate, piquette, vinasse, vin bleu
    Hypernym: vin
  2. (colloquial, by extension) Synonym of vin (any wine)
    • 1975, “Hexagone”, in Amoureux de Paname, performed by Renaud:
      Leur pinard et leur camembert / C’est leur seule gloire à ces tarés
      Their wine and their Camembert / Are the only glory these cretins have
